Inside a manufacturing facility in Klin, Russia, an industrial CNC lathe or turning center is depicted mid-operation. A cylindrical metallic workpiece, appearing to be aluminum or steel, is securely clamped by a three-jaw chuck on its left end. The right end of the workpiece is supported by a tailstock equipped with a drill chuck or live center. The workpiece exhibits machining marks, suggesting a turning process is either ongoing or recently completed. The interior surfaces of the machine, including its light-colored back wall and darker base, are spattered with silver-colored metal shavings (chips) and dark cutting fluid or coolant, which has accumulated in the machine's lower collection channels. The machine components show signs of regular industrial use, with visible wear and residue. No personnel are visible within the frame.
